
His 'N' Hers marks a pivotal moment in Pulp's career, blending sharp lyrical storytelling with a unique fusion of rock and pop. Released in 1994, the album established Pulp as one of the defining voices of '90s British music, with Jarvis Cocker's evocative lyrics and infectious melodies capturing the complexities of everyday life.
This edition showcases the band's signature sound—cheesy disco-pop soaked in nostalgia and clever narratives—culminating in the spoken word-driven "David’s Last Summer." The album’s consistent style and memorable songwriting make it a standout for both new listeners and long-time fans seeking to experience one of Pulp's most celebrated works.
